On NCIS Season 12 Episode 6, someone has killed the wife of a Navy Commander, and the NCIS team has to figure out who did it and why.

At first, they suspect that her murder is part of a jihadist plot against her husband. So they explore that angle by setting up a sting on the person who runs the jihadist website.

Then they examine the women's psychiatric patients to see if one of them may have had a deadly grudge against her.

The clues are sparse and difficult to parse: they have the bullet that killed her, some testimony from her 10 year old daughter who said that her dad had prepared her and her mother in case of an attack, and some information from a jailed sociopath whose disturbing crimes include murder and cannabilism.

The little girl had been suffered injuries in the past, as had her mother. And a neighbor had noticed that the woman had shown nervousness whenever her husband was around her daughter.

The final answer is as surprising as it is jarring.

Meanwhile, Tony's team mates attempt to play matchmaker for him when an old Philly PD partner shows up during a failed sting operation. And Abby finally confronts Tony about his frat boy ways.
